 6363 BugsMusic playbackVery Low Wrong WPS after skip back at the end of a song 2006-11-20Alexander Levin2006-11-211 Task Description

The bug can be reproduced with the build CVS-061118 and a MP3 file with 128kbps and 44100 Hz (created with LAME encoder through CDEx GUI).
Device: Iriver H120.

How to reproduce:

1. Start a song (song A). I used a song of about 3 min length.
2. Wait until it’s come to about 10 secs before the end. You can also use fast forward button to faster get to this point.
3. Wait until it gets to 2 or 1 or 0 secs before the end (I use the remaining duration in WPS). WIth 3 secs before the end, the error does not occur.
4. Press left. This should start the song A from the beginning since it’s still displayed in the WPS.

However, the next song (song B) starts. If the remaining time was 2 secs it goes down to 0. But the WPS still displays the song A. Progress bar and time in the WPS are frozen at the end of the song A (e.g. remaining duration is 0:00). After pressing NAVI (which displays the file browser), the cursor is on the song A. Pressing PLAY (cursor has not been moved) gets back to WPS. There, the song B with correct progress bar and time indicators is displayed.

Here is also the configuration file (exported just before submitting this bug report) – in order to avoid many questions about the settings.

 5906 BugsMusic playbackVery Low Wrong rebuffering after playback resume, rewind and tra ...2006-08-30Václav Brožík72006-10-17 Task Description

Probably the CVS update from 31 Jul 08:12 solved one serious bug in playback but one similar minor bug still remains.

How to reproduce it:
1. Play an MP3 file (not the last one in a directory).
2. Seek near to the end of the file (i.e. 30 seconds before the end).
3. Stop the playback. (A resume point is stored.)
4. Resume the playback by pressing PLAY.
5. Seek before the time point of resume. (Rockbock will rebuffer.)
6. Wait till the beginning of the next track.
7. Sometimes (always?) the following happens:
- Rockbox will rebuffer again.
- A short part (fraction of a second) of the beggining of the file will be played twice.
- During the first playback the displayed time will show 0:00 or a nonsensical time.

Last time the bug was tested on the firmware CVS 060830-1432 with the default settings on iriver H120.
The bug could not be reproduced with OGG (whole file is buffered) and WV files.

 5570 BugsMusic playbackVery Low Voicing causes freeze on music playback 2006-06-19Mike Holden172006-08-291 Task Description

If I enable voicing of any kind, then it causes major problems on my 340, with a daily build from the last couple of days. Currently loaded is CVS-20060619.

First off, no file/dir voicing occurs.

Second off, when I play a music file, although the file loads and the WPS shows correct data, no playback occurs, and the counter sticks at 0:00. Sometimes you will hear a tiny fraction of playback, but nothing more. The unit just stops there. It will respond ok to pause/play, and will respond to stop. However when pressing stop, it gets as far as the Creating Bookmark splash, and locks up completely, needing a hard reset with a paperclip.

After a bit of messing around trying to find which build broke it (it used to work, so I thought) I finally hit on what the problem is - while investigating another issue with voicing, I renamed my english.voice file to stop it being loaded on bootup, and this is totally the cause of the problem. If I rename it back to english.voice, everyting works as expected, but if in rename it to EEEenglish.voice, then file/dir voicings fail, and the unit locks up as described above.

The workaround is obvious (load the file and name it correctly), but this bug will hit any user who wants to voice files and dirs, but who doesn’t have an appropriate voice file loaded.

 10101 BugsMusic playbackVery Low track skipping stops file buffering 2009-04-05Jonathan Gordon62009-06-101 Task Description

start playback, wait for a few sec then skip to the next track. disk activity should stop.. check the buffering debug screen and userfl, alloc and real should all be way below where you would expect (i.e <50%).

the “problem” here looks like the skip track kills buffering. We need to decide if we want to fix this or not.
The biggest annoyance from this is that there will be no next track info until the next buffer… Usually when the buffer is filled the first track that didn’t fit gets its id3 buffered separately so there is almost always something to display. This doesn’t happen until the end of buffering, and because its getting cut short there is nothing loaded, so nothing to display.

apart from that its not really an issue, just makes an etxra buffering earlier than it should
